7cworldwide said:Soteriologically speaking, those who hold to prevenient grace believe that God grants the ability (grace) for the unregenerate to seek Him and then make a free-will choice whether or not to accept salvation. They believe this element of grace is given to ALL. I see it as quite the opposite of irresistible grace.
mlqurgw said:Prevenient grace is that grace which kept you before the Spirit regenerated you. I am sure you can lok back on times that God preserved you and blocked your way from going into such sin or even death that woulsd have ruined you. Wesley ( for the life of me I can't remember how to spell his name) expounded previent grace as that grace which comes to all men but can be rejected.
